
The Gannon University Psychological Services Clinic is a training facility for doctoral students in the practice of counseling psychology. Therapists in training are currently working towards a Ph.D. in Counseling Psychology. Many are experienced master’s level practitioners before entering the program. The Clinic offers free comprehensive counseling services to members of the greater Erie community. These services include individual psychotherapy for adults, adolescents, and children; marital and family therapy as well as couple therapy; group therapy and career counseling.
